At 86 Rue Charonne, the Jöro office is placed in a historically artistic and currently creative sector of the 11th arrondissement. The neighborhood is vibrant and densely populated, known for its mix of traditional workshops, new concept stores, and popular dining venues. The area benefits from proximity to the Bastille and Faubourg Saint-Antoine. Transport is accessible via the Charonne Metro station. The overall vibe is highly dynamic and appealing to a creative, entrepreneurial workforce, offering a strong social scene alongside practical urban convenience.
Commuting
This dynamic 11th arrondissement location is characterized by its local transport convenience, integrating smoothly into the urban environment for a rapid and simple commute. Key transit links and minimal walking distances include a minimal 100 meter walk to Métro Charonne (Line 9), ensuring immediate access to the central axis. The major intersection of Bastille (Métro Lines 1, 5, 8) is easily reachable within 800 meters, linking to the eastern and southern parts of the city. For those using sustainable transport, local streets offer secure cycling infrastructure, promoting a quick and flexible commute in this highly active district.
